Webpackの基本とプロジェクトへの導入 – JavaScriptで始めるプログラミング
Webpackは、JavaScriptアプリケーションのモジュールバンドラーとして広く使われているツールです。さらに、複数のファイルを一つにまとめて効率的に管理できます。以下では、Webpackの基本とプロジェクトへの導入方法を説明します。
Webpackとは?
まず、Webpackは依存関係を解析しながら、コードを効率的にバンドルします。その結果、プロジェクト内の複雑な関係性を整理しやすくなります。
Webpackの基本機能
- モジュールバンドリング:複数のJavaScriptファイルを一つのファイルにまとめます。
- コードスプリッティング:必要に応じて複数のバンドルに分けることができます。
- ロードタイムオプティマイゼーション:ロード時間を短縮するための最適化を行います。
Webpackの導入方法
- Node.jsとnpmをインストールします。
- プロジェクトディレクトリでwebpackとwebpack-cliをインストールします。
- JavaScriptファイルを準備し、
webpack.config.js
ファイルを作成します。 npm run build
コマンドを実行してビルドを行います。
フロントエンド開発者
「Webpackの導入により、開発効率が飛躍的に向上しました。また、バンドルされたコードはパフォーマンスの向上にも繋がります。」
具体的な例
例えば、以下のようにwebpack.config.js
ファイルを設定することができます。
const path = require('path');
module.exports = {
entry: './src/index.js',
output: {
filename: 'bundle.js',
path: path.resolve(__dirname, 'dist')
},
mode: 'development'
};
Webpack公式サイト(外部リンク)でさらに詳細な情報を得ることができます。
まとめ
以上のように、「Webpack」はJavaScriptプロジェクトにおいて欠かせないツールです。より効率的な開発を目指すためにも、導入を検討してみてはいかがでしょうか。以上、Webpackの基本とプロジェクトへの導入についての説明でした。